Are you a product leader who accelerates secure, best-in-class native mobile experiences by turning standards into scalable, reusable requirements teams ship with confidence? If so, you've found the right team!

As a Shared Services Product Associate within our mobile services organization, you accelerate secure, best-in-class native mobile experiences by turning standards into scalable, reusable requirements teams ship with confidence. This role focuses on requirements coaching, mobile UX standards, non-functional requirements (NFRs), mobile value-add capabilities, and security-by-design considerations. Success will be measured through improved delivery throughput and reduced partner build issues.

Job Responsibilities

  • Partner enablement on requirements: Coach partner teams to produce clear, testable requirements, including user stories, acceptance criteria, edge cases, analytics needs, accessibility requirements, and localization considerations.
  • Mobile experience standards: Socialize and reinforce native mobile experience standards such as navigation patterns, error and empty states, accessibility, performance expectations, and offline/poor network behavior.
  • NFR definition & governance: Create reusable NFR templates for mobile delivery (e.g., reliability, latency, crash-free rate, app size, battery impact, observability, and resilience).
  • Security-by-design: Ensure requirements incorporate appropriate security and privacy controls, including authentication and session handling, data-at-rest and data-in-transit expectations, secure storage, jailbreak/root detection considerations, and logging hygiene.
  • Value-add mobile capabilities: Enable teams to appropriately leverage platform-native capabilities such as push notifications, biometrics, deep links, camera/file flows, device permissions, and feature flagging.
  • Intake & prioritization: Run a lightweight intake process for partner requests; triage, size, prioritize, and route work across shared services contributors.
  • Reusable assets: Build and maintain playbooks, requirement checklists, reference user stories, and sample acceptance criteria to reduce rework and improve consistency.
  • Cross-functional alignment: Partner with design, engineering, security, and QA to standardize patterns, drive adoption, and remove delivery friction.
  • Continuous improvement: Use issue trends and partner feedback to refine standards and templates, driving measurable reductions in defects and cycle time.

JPMorgan Chase & Co. is an American multinational banking institution headquartered in New York City and incorporated in Delaware. It is the largest bank in the United States, and the world's largest bank by market capitalization as of 2025.
